Auerbach: Celloquy. © 2013 Cedille Records

Russian composer Lera Auerbach's new recording of original works for cello and piano offers listeners an endless palette of original and provocative musical ideas. From a stylistic standpoint, Auerbach's music is accessible to a general audience, but not so familiar as to harp on tired ideas. This balance between tradition and novelty is one of the album's most attractive qualities.

From Bachian compound lines (Preludes in D major and G-flat major, tracks 5 and 13), to spirited Mendelssohnian bursts of energy (Prelude in A major, track 7), to stark and relentless Shostakovichian ostinati (Preludes in B major and D minor, tracks 11 and 24), the preludes channel voices from the past and mould them into a modern kaleidoscopic array of sonic beauty...
